CM: Penang can’t afford to acquire High Chaparral land

Penang Chief Minister Guan Eng makes several points:

  • The crisis was created under the previous BN administration;
  • The Buah Pala villagers should distinguish between their friends and those responsible for their predicament;

  • The Penang government has to act according to the law;
  • The Penang state government cannot afford to re-acquire the 6.5 acre plot of land, he claims: “I don’t even want to try and guess the amount.” (The previous BN state government had reportedly sold the land to the developers for only RM3.2 million or about RM11 per square foot in 2005.)

The following is a chronology of events prepared by an activist:

Kronologi

1950-2005

Tanah Kampung Buah Pala terletak di bawah Housing Trust Act 1950 dan penduduknya membayar TOL (temporary occupation licence) setiap tahun kepada Pejabat Tanah

1999

Penduduk Kampung Buah Pala memohon Kerajaan Persekutuan untuk melindungi warisan Kampung Buah Pala sebagai kampung tradisi India

2005

Pejabat Tanah tidak mahu menerima bayaran TOL oleh Kampung Buah Pala.

Tanah kemudian dijual sebanyak RM3.21juta kepada Koperasi Pegawai Kerajaan Pulau Pinang Berhad (KPKPP) dan Nusmetro Venture Sdn Bhd Pinang. Nusmetro dan KPKPP memberi notis pengusiran kepada penduduk-penduduk Kampung Buah Pala.

27 Mac 2008

Tanah dipindah dari tangan Kerajaan Negeri/Persekutuan (trustee) kepada Nusmetro Venture Sdn Bhd dan KPKPP. Penduduk Kampung Buah Pala membawa kes ini ke Mahkamah Tinggi

Oktober 2008

Kampung Buah Pala menang di Mahkamah Tinggi.
KPKPP membawa kes ke Mahkamah Rayuan Persekutuan.

18 Jan 2009

Perayaan Ponggal untuk merayakan warisan berusia hampir 200 tahun Kampung Buah Pala. Banyak wakil rakyat termasuk Anwar Ibrahim berjanji untuk berjuang untuk Kg Buah Pala.

11 Mei 2009

Pemaju tanah menang kes di Mahkamah Rayuan Persekutuan. Penduduk Kampung Buah Pala diberi notis pengusiran 30 hari.

6 Jun 2009

Sidang akhbar memberi nafas baru kepada isu Kampung Buah Pala.

8 Jun 2009

Mesyuarat antara Kerajaan Negeri dan Pertubuhan Penduduk-Penduduk Kg Buah Pala. Kerajaan Negeri menubuhkan jawatankuasa penyiasatan untuk isu tanah Kg Buah Pala. Penduduk-penduduk menekan bahawa mereka tidak akan menyerah tanah mereka kepada pemaju tanah.

11 Jun 2009

Hari ke-30 dari notis pengusiran. Lori penuh dengan batu konkrit datang tapi patah balik selepas gagal masuk ke Kg Buah Pala.

16 Jun 2009

Case management di Mahkamah Persekutuan

19 Jun 2009

Perhimpunan lilin di Kg Buah Pala

24 June 2009

Hearing di Mahkamah Persekutuan
